A purchase option assures the option holder of the right to purchase property at a certain price within a certain time period but without an obligation to do so. In granting an option, the landowner gives up the right to sell freely during the option period.
An option to purchase is an agreement that gives a potential buyer (“optionee”) the right, but not the obligation, to buy property in the future. The optionee must decide by a certain time whether to “exercise” the option and thereafter by bound under the contract to purchase.
Definition: A first option to buy, also known as a right of preemption, is a contractual agreement that gives a potential buyer the first opportunity to purchase a property or asset at a specified price if the seller decides to sell within a certain period of time.

No matter the format, an option to purchase must: 1) state the option fee, 2) set the duration of the option period, 3) outline the price for which the tenant will purchase the property in the future, and 4) comply with local and state laws.

A right of first offer (ROFO) clause dictates that an owner must negotiate with a right holder before selling or leasing their property to a third party. However, they may consider outside offers. While ROFOs and ROFRs are similar, only ROFOs allow owners to receive offers from outside parties.

An options contract is an agreement whereby the contract buyer purchases the right but not the obligation to exercise the right and buy or sell shares of stock. A right of first refusal is the right but not the obligation to match an offer someone else has made on an asset and purchase it.
